As per the Central Railway recruitment notification, candidates must meet the following age criteria as of January 1, 2026:
Minimum Age: 18 Years
Maximum Age: 30 Years
Relaxation in the upper age limit is provided for reserved categories as per government rules:
OBC Candidates: 3 Years
SC/ST Candidates: 5 Years
PWBD (UR) Candidates: 10 Years
PWBD (OBC) Candidates: 13 Years
PWBD (SC/ST) Candidates: 15 Years
Educational Qualification
To be eligible for the Cultural Quota positions, candidates should possess a fundamental academic background, having completed their 10th, 12th, Diploma, or Degree from a recognized board or university. However, alongside academic qualifications, candidates must possess professional qualifications and proven experience in their respective cultural fields (Percussion or Classical Singing). Central Railway Recruitment 2025 Selection Process
The selection of candidates for the Cultural Quota will be a comprehensive process designed to assess both theoretical knowledge and practical skills. The process will likely include the following stages:
Written Test: A written examination (CBT or Tab mode) will be conducted to evaluate the general awareness and knowledge of the candidates.
Practical Demonstration/Skill Test: Candidates who qualify in the written test will be called for a practical assessment to demonstrate their proficiency in their respective cultural fields.
Final selection will be based on the cumulative performance in both the written test and the practical skill test.
